Common Glass Railing Systems Problems We See in Muscoy Homes
- Unpermitted county work coming back to bite. A handyman installs a glass rail without San Bernardino County approval. An October Santa Ana gust stresses the anchors, a neighbor complains, and the county red-tags the whole thing. Fixing that usually costs more than doing it right the first time.
- Anchor creep on thin patio lips. 1950s Muscoy slabs are often only 3-4 inches thick at the patio edge. Drilled anchors for glass posts can crack the slab if they’re placed too close to the lip. We set posts back and use wider base plates where needed.
- Thermal stress on frameless panels. The temperature swing between a 105°F Muscoy afternoon and a sudden Santa Ana pressure change will find every weak point in an undersized tempered panel. West-facing decks see this first.
- Sliding glass doors jumping their tracks. This is a Muscoy October classic. The same wind that stresses your railing can warp a 1960s aluminum slider frame and send the door off its track. If you’re doing a deck railing permit, we’ll check the door while we’re there.
Pricing for Glass Railing Systems in Muscoy, CA
Here are straight numbers for Muscoy work. A cable railing system on a typical 20-foot Muscoy deck runs $3,200 to $5,800 installed, depending on post spacing and the number of corners. Frameless glass rail for the same deck runs $4,500 to $8,200, with the higher end reflecting thicker tempered panels sized for Santa Ana wind loads. Interior glass railing for a standard staircase typically runs $2,800 to $5,500. Pool glass fencing starts around $180 per linear foot and climbs with gate hardware and self-closing requirements. | Muscoy Glass Railing Project | Typical Installed Range |
|---|---|
| Cable railing, 20-ft deck | $3,200 - $5,800 |
| Frameless glass rail, 20-ft deck | $4,500 - $8,200 |
| Interior glass railing, standard staircase | $2,800 - $5,500 |
| Pool glass fencing, per linear foot | $180 - $320 |
A few things move the number in Muscoy specifically. If your deck faces the foothills and takes the full brunt of the Santa Anas, expect stamped engineering calcs in the permit package and a slightly heavier glass spec. If your side yard is too narrow to stage panels, we may need to coordinate a street drop, which adds a little logistics cost. We’ll walk you through all of it before you sign anything.
How We Handle Tight Muscoy Lots
Muscoy lots are small, and the side yards are often only a few feet wide. That shapes the whole job. Last fall we put a frameless glass rail system on a 1960s flat-roof tract home off Cajon Boulevard, where the back patio sat about 18 inches above grade. Our crew had to stage all the tempered glass panels and posts in the narrow side yard, and we pulled county permits with stamped wind-load calcs after the owners told us their old aluminum slider had jumped its track twice the previous October. Because the lot was tight and the neighbor’s stucco wall was only four feet away, we built a temp plywood corral to keep glass shards out of their yard, and we scheduled the noisy concrete-core drilling between 8:00 and 4:30 to stay inside the county’s unincorporated-area noise window.

The Muscoy Permit Path, Explained
Because Muscoy is unincorporated, every glass railing permit goes through the San Bernardino County building department. County reviewers routinely require wind-load calculations for exterior glass rails here, because they know what the Santa Anas do to this valley. A contractor who is used to pulling permits at a city hall in a neighboring town may not know that, and the result is a permit that stalls or a railing that gets red-tagged.
